St. Patty's parades fill the weekend

Western New Yorkers will have the opportunity to enjoy two St. Patty's Day parades this weekend. The Old Neighborhood parade will march through the Old First Ward today, beginning at noon. The Buffalo city parade kicks off at two along Delaware Avenue on Sunday. South Buffalo Common Council member Chris Scanlon encourages everyone to embrace the warmer weather and enjoy the fun.

"This weekend's a wonderful opportunity for people of Buffalo and throughout Western New York to get out and celebrate our city, celebrate our Irish heritage. If you're not Irish, get out and celebrate and pretend that you are. I know so many people do."

Local authorities warn that DWI checkpoints will be operating throughout the weekend, and a crackdown on underage drinking and open container laws will be employed as well.
